All 32 participants for the group stage of the 2025 Copa Libertadores—South America’s equivalent of the UEFA Champions League—are now confirmed. Brazil leads the way with seven representatives, the highest among participating nations. These clubs will be split into eight groups of four when the draw takes place on March 18 at 00:00 CET.

Ahead of the draw, the teams have been placed into four seeding pots:

Pot 1
• Botafogo (Brazil)
• River Plate (Argentina)
• Palmeiras (Brazil)
• Flamengo (Brazil)
• Peñarol (Uruguay)
• Nacional (Uruguay)
• São Paulo (Brazil)
• Racing (Argentina)

Pot 2
• Olimpia (Paraguay)
• LDU Quito (Ecuador)
• Internacional (Brazil)
• Libertad (Paraguay)
• Independiente del Valle (Ecuador)
• Colo-Colo (Chile)
• Estudiantes (Argentina)
• Bolívar (Bolivia)

Pot 3
• Atlético Nacional (Colombia)
• Vélez Sarsfield (Argentina)
• Fortaleza (Brazil)
• Sporting Cristal (Peru)
• Universitario (Peru)
• Talleres (Argentina)
• Deportivo Táchira (Venezuela)
• Universidad de Chile (Chile)

Pot 4
• Carabobo (Venezuela)
• Atlético Bucaramanga (Colombia)
• Central Córdoba (Argentina)
• San Antonio Bulo Bulo (Bolivia)
• Alianza Lima (Peru)
• Bahia (Brazil)
• Cerro Porteño (Paraguay)
• Barcelona SC (Ecuador)

Per the tournament regulations, the top two teams in each group will advance to the knockout phase. The opening round of group-stage matches is scheduled for April 1–3.
